Hi all,

Noticed on a few games but particularly Hyper Sports that my MAME cab doesn't seem to register fast button presses. So in Track & Field for instance you can press the run buttons alternately quite fast but if you hammer them rapidly (as I'm used to from the arcade days 😁) you actually slow down.

Hi, I bought the cabinet ready built so I've had to investigate the details...

It's Windows 7, MAME 0.210

It uses a zero delay encoder. It is usb connected.

There is definitely a slight issue because in other games which require rapid presses like Pac-Land, Toobin' and 1942 you can't get the speed I know you should.

Reading elsewhere a suggestion was to try changing the keyboard repeat delay / repeat rate?

Well its not ancient which is usually the case but you are using a version from 2019. There have been significant improvements especially with sound since that version so you really should take the time to update to the latest version.

According to this guy, some arcade buttons cannot respond fast enough.
No doubt keyboards would be worse.
